Advanced Medical-Surgical Nursing Principles –
Exam 1 Study Guide (Jersey College)




What during labor increases the risk of neonate
aquiring acute encephalitis? - Answer--active herpes
simplex virus-2

How do you administer meds? - Answer--starting with
the lowest dose and titrating up slowly

,What is pain is associated with? - Answer--actual or
potential tissue damage

When pain stimulates the sympathetic nervous
system, what does it result in? - Answer--- increase in
BP
- increase in HR
- increase in RR

Where are catecholamines released from? -
Answer--adrenal medulla

Where are steroid hormones (cortisol & aldosterone)
released from? - Answer--adrenal cortex

What does unrelieved pain lead to? - Answer---
increases glucagon production
- decreases insulin secretion
- depress immune function
- can lead to addictive behaviors

What initiates inflammation, contributes to tissue
sweeling, and pain? - Answer--Prostaglandins

,What can nerve root injury lead to? -
Answer--allodynia (pain that is associated with
non-noxious stimuli)

What is needed for renal blood flow? -
Answer--Prostaglandin

Pain is? - Answer--whatever the patient says it is

What is the single most reliable indicator of pain? -
Answer--the patient's self-report

How do NSAID's preimarily produce pain relief? -
Answer--by preventing prostaglandin formation

What does acetaminphen not have? - Answer--any
inflammatory properties

What do you manage nociceptive pain with? -
Answer--- local anesthetics
- non-opioids
- opioids

What does 0 on the 0 - 10 numeric pain rating scale
indicate? - Answer--no pain

, What does the Wong-Baker FACES pain scale consist
of? - Answer--cartoon faces that the patient (ages 3
and up) selects to report thier pain level

What does the visual analog 10cm scale represent? -
Answer--no pain to the worst pain, the patient marks a
spot somewhere in between indicating their pain level

What pain scale helps indiviuals describe the intensity
of pain? - Answer--verbal descriptor scale

What does a comprehensive pain assessment consist
of? - Answer--- duration (when it started/lasted)
- type (intensity/assoc factors/influencing fators)
- location

What patients do we avoid the rectal route for med
administration? - Answer--thrombocytopenic

What type of effect do topical agents produce? -
Answer--local

What type of effect do transdermal agents produce? -
Answer--drug absorption into the systemic circulation

What would help reduce complications related to pain
for patients? - Answer--provide a PCA
